Activity Log, Graph & Heatmap

Track every change, visualize every trend. CountTogether's activity log records all counter changes with timestamps and user info. The built-in graph and contribution heatmap let you spot patterns and trends at a glance.

Every increment, decrement, and edit is recorded with the exact time and the person who made the change. The interactive graph shows how your counter evolved over time, while the heatmap highlights your most active days – making it easy to track consistency and spot trends.

Questions fréquentes

What information is recorded in the activity log?

The activity log records every counter change including the type of action (increment, decrement, edit), the amount of change, the timestamp, and the user who made the change. This gives you a complete picture of your counter's history.

Can all shared counter members see the activity log?

Yes, the activity log is visible to all members of a shared counter. This ensures full transparency and helps teams stay coordinated and accountable.

Is there a limit to how far back the history goes?

The activity log keeps a comprehensive history of counter changes. You can scroll back through the entire history to review any past changes and understand how your counter evolved over time.
